About me

I was first elected on to the council in May 2005 where I’m Shadow Cabinet Member for Communities and a member of the Health and Adult Care Improvement and Scrutiny Committee.

I’m a governor on Dallimore Primary School, Kirk Hallam Sports and Community Technology College and Bennerley Fields School, which has specialist Communication and Language status and enrols children from a wide area.

I’m also a member of Ilkeston Age Concern Group, supporting our local luncheon clubs and volunteers.

I believe people are the heart of a community and became involved with voluntary work in 1997, working as a volunteer with older people and helping to set up a youth club with similar minded neighbours.

I’m passionate about speaking up for and acting on behalf of people, so the best part of my job is giving local people a louder voice, especially on how their council services are provided.
